gearmulator

Emulation of classic VA synths of the late 90s/2000s that are based on Motorola 56300 family DSPs
Log | Files | Refs | Submodules | README | LICENSE

commit 1f67b84add570d4344330260dc099ed06d93bc29
parent 28777e06d4f1f4f6f5459a817a3eb296dabdac09
Author: dsp56300 <lyve2909+githubdsp56300@gmail.com>
Date:   Wed, 14 Jul 2021 15:31:20 +0200

fix invalid linker flags for apple & win

Diffstat:
MCMakeLists.txt | 6+++++-
Msource/jucePlugin/CMakeLists.txt | 4++++
2 files changed, 9 insertions(+), 1 deletion(-)

diff --git a/CMakeLists.txt b/CMakeLists.txt @@ -38,7 +38,11 @@ endif() add_executable(virusTestConsole) target_sources(virusTestConsole PRIVATE source/virusTestConsole/virusTestConsole.cpp) -target_link_libraries(virusTestConsole PUBLIC virusLib -static-libgcc -static-libstdc++) +target_link_libraries(virusTestConsole PUBLIC virusLib) + +if(UNIX AND NOT APPLE) + target_link_libraries(virusTestConsole -static-libgcc -static-libstdc++) +endif() # ----------------- CPack diff --git a/source/jucePlugin/CMakeLists.txt b/source/jucePlugin/CMakeLists.txt @@ -49,3 +49,7 @@ PUBLIC #juce::juce_recommended_warning_flags -static-libgcc -static-libstdc++ ) + +if(UNIX AND NOT APPLE) + target_link_libraries(jucePlugin -static-libgcc -static-libstdc++) +endif()